20150235196 | Payment method and device - Disclosed are a payment method and device. With the method, after a payment request is received from a terminal, a two-dimensional code containing payment information of an account corresponding to the two-dimensional code is acquired from the terminal; the payment information of the account in the two-dimensional code is read; and the account is charged using the payment information according to the payment request. With the disclosure, a solution for cumbersome payment for a product in an electronic store in related art is provided, providing a user with a fast and convenient way to pay for a product in an electronic store, and increasing user experience. | 08-20-2015 |

20120281702 | METHOD, SYSTEM, AND DEVICE FOR ESTABLISHING PSEUDO WIRE - A method, a system, and a device for establishing a pseudo wire are disclosed. The method includes: receiving, by a switching provider edge at a bifurcation position, a label mapping message, obtaining information of the switching provider edge at the bifurcation position and information of at least two next hops or outgoing interfaces of the switching provider edge through parsing, comparing the information of the switching provider edge at the bifurcation position with information of a local device, and if the information of the switching provider edge at the bifurcation position matches with the information of the local device, establishing at least two pseudo wires from the switching provider edge according to the information of at least two next hops or outgoing interfaces. | 11-08-2012 |

20140355933 | OPTICAL CIRCUIT SWITCH WITH INTEGRAL CIRCULATORS - Optical circuit switches and switching methods are described. A first optical circulator may form a first plurality of bidirectional optical beams from a first plurality of input optical beams and a corresponding first plurality of output optical beams. Each bidirectional optical beam may consist of the corresponding input optical beam and the corresponding output optical beam overlaid to follow, in opposing directions, a common optical path. A first mirror array may be disposed to reflect the first plurality of bidirectional optical beams. | 12-04-2014 |
20150355411 | OPTICAL CIRCUIT SWITCH WITH INTEGRAL CIRCULATORS - Optical circuit switches and switching methods are described. An optical circulator may form a first plurality of bidirectional optical beams from a first plurality of input optical beams and a corresponding first plurality of output optical beams. Each bidirectional optical beam may consist of the corresponding input optical beam and the corresponding output optical beam overlaid to follow, in opposing directions, a common optical path. A mirror array may be disposed to reflect the first plurality of bidirectional optical beams. A reflector may be disposed to intercept bidirectional optical beams reflected from the mirror array and to reflect at least some of the intercepted bidirectional optical beams back to the mirror array. | 12-10-2015 |
